To John Jay from Floridablanca, 24 March 1781

From Floridablanca

[au Pardo ce 24 Mars 1781]

Le Comte de Floridablanca a reçu la Lettre que Mr Jay l’a fait l’honneur de lui ecrire, et au sujet de son contenu, il peut lui dire qu’il se remet entieremt. a ce que Mr De Campo signifiera a Mr Gardoqui, comm’ etant tous les deux au fait des affaires en question.

[Translation]

at the Pardo this 24 March 1781

Count Floridablanca has received the Letter that Mr. Jay has had the honor to write him,1 and on the subject of its contents, he can inform him that he should trust entirely to what Mr. De Campo will tell Mr. Gardoqui, since both are informed about the matters in question.2

RC, NNC (EJ: 8230). C, in JJ’s hand, FrPMAE: CP-E, 603 (EJ: 4012). Translation by the editors.

1JJ to Floridablanca, 22 Mar., above. See also Gardoqui to JJ, 25 Mar. 1781, below, in which the present letter was enclosed.

2JJ enclosed a copy of this letter in his letter to BF of 28 Mar. 1781, below.
